6. Cookies and Analytics
6.1 What Are Cookies?
Cookies are small text files that are placed on your device when you visit a website. We use cookies and similar technologies (such as pixels, tags, and local storage) to recognize your browser or device, store preferences, and understand how visitors use the Site.
6.2 Types of Cookies We Use
• Strictly Necessary Cookies: Required for the Site to function properly (e.g., to enable page navigation, maintain sessions, or secure forms). You cannot opt out of these cookies via our cookie controls.
• Functional Cookies: Help remember your settings and preferences (such as language or display options) to provide a more personalized experience.
• Analytics and Performance Cookies: Help us understand how visitors interact with the Site (e.g., which pages are visited, how long visitors stay, and any errors encountered).
• Advertising or Targeting Cookies (if used): Used to deliver relevant ads or measure the effectiveness of marketing campaigns, including across different websites and devices. If we use advertising cookies, we will provide additional disclosures and, where required, obtain your consent.
6.3 Managing Cookies
Depending on your location and applicable law:
• You may see a cookie banner or preference center when you first visit the Site, allowing you to accept or reject certain cookies.
• You can also control cookies through your browser settings by blocking or deleting them. However, some features of the Site may not work correctly if you disable certain cookies.
For detailed instructions, consult your browser’s help documentation.

9. Your Privacy Rights
Your privacy rights may vary depending on your place of residence. Below is a general summary of the rights that may be available to you.
9.1 Rights Under Certain U.S. State Laws
Residents of certain U.S. states (including, without limitation, California, Colorado, Connecticut, Utah, Virginia, and others as applicable) may have some or all of the following rights with respect to their Personal Information:
• Right to Know / Access: To request confirmation as to whether we process your Personal Information and to access that information, including categories and specific pieces of Personal Information we have collected.
• Right to Deletion: To request that we delete certain Personal Information we have collected from you, subject to legal exceptions.
• Right to Correction: To request that we correct inaccuracies in your Personal Information, taking into account the nature of the information and the purposes of processing.
• Right to Data Portability: To request a copy of certain Personal Information in a portable and, where technically feasible, readily usable format.
• Right to Opt Out of Certain Processing: Depending on your state, this may include the right to opt out of:
o “Sale” of Personal Information (as the term is defined by applicable law);
o Targeted advertising or cross-context behavioral advertising;
o Certain profiling activities that produce legal or similarly significant effects.
• Right to Non-Discrimination: We will not discriminate against you for exercising any of your privacy rights, such as by denying goods or services, charging different prices, or providing a different level of quality, except as permitted by law (for example, in connection with certain financial incentives).
